    Understanding the Challenges of Day-to-Year Conversion

    The primary challenge lies in the inconsistent lengths of months. Unlike years, which have a consistent number of days (excluding leap years), months vary between 28 and 31 days. This variability makes a direct, simple division impossible. You can't simply divide the total number of days by 365 (or 365.25 to account for leap years) to get an accurate year count, as this will neglect the variations in the length of months. The same is true for months; dividing the remaining days by 30 will result in only an approximation.

    Therefore, we need methods that account for this variability to achieve accurate results.

    Method 1: Manual Calculation (for smaller numbers of days)

    For relatively small numbers of days, manual calculation can be manageable. This method is best suited for situations where you don't need extreme precision or are dealing with a limited number of days.

    Steps:

    1. Determine the number of years: Divide the total number of days by 365 (or 365.25 for greater accuracy, accounting for leap years). The integer portion of the result is the number of years.

    2. Calculate the remaining days: Subtract the number of days accounted for by the years (years * 365 or years * 365.25) from the total number of days.

    3. Determine the number of months: Divide the remaining days by 30 (an average month length). The integer portion is an approximate number of months. This step provides only an estimate.

    4. Calculate the remaining days (again): Subtract the number of days accounted for by the months (months * 30) from the remaining days. This provides the final number of days.

    Example:

    Let's say we have 1500 days.

    1. Years: 1500 / 365 ≈ 4 years (with a remainder).
    2. Remaining days: 1500 - (4 * 365) = 1500 - 1460 = 40 days
    3. Months: 40 / 30 ≈ 1 month (with a remainder).
    4. Remaining days: 40 - (1 * 30) = 10 days

    Therefore, 1500 days is approximately 4 years, 1 month, and 10 days. Note: This is an approximation due to the use of average month length.

    Method 3: Programming Solutions (Python)

    Programming languages offer the most flexible and accurate method for this conversion. Python, with its extensive date and time libraries, is particularly well-suited for this task.

    Python Code:

    import datetime
    
    def days_to_ymd(total_days):
        """Converts a number of days into years, months, and days."""
        start_date = datetime.date(1, 1, 1)  # Starting date
        end_date = start_date + datetime.timedelta(days=total_days)
        years = end_date.year - 1
        months = end_date.month -1
        days = end_date.day
    
        #Adjusting for the start date being 1,1,1 and the fact that we are working with a timedelta.
        if months==0 and days==1:
            return years-1, 12, 31
        elif months==0 and days !=1:
            return years-1, 12, days+30
        elif months!=0 and days==1:
            return years, months, 1
        else:
            return years, months, days
    
    
    
    total_days = 1500
    years, months, days = days_to_ymd(total_days)
    print(f"{total_days} days is equal to {years} years, {months} months, and {days} days.")
    
    

    This Python code utilizes the datetime library to accurately handle leap years and varying month lengths. The output will be significantly more accurate than the manual calculation method.
